V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Distributions
Ubuntu
Fedora
CentOS
中文资源站
网易开源镜像站
FreeWriting
V2EX  ›  Linux

想配台电脑用来学习 Linux,求推荐便宜省事的方案

  •  
  •   FreeWriting · 2013-08-15 09:52:27 +08:00 · 10111 次点击
    这是一个创建于 4120 天前的主题,其中的信息可能已经有所发展或是发生改变。
    第 1 条附言  ·  2013-08-15 11:13:17 +08:00
    #25

    谢谢各位的回答。

    我可能没说明白,我不只是想学 Linux CLI,而是想学习在 Linux 下的开发。之前一直在 Windows 中使用和学习 emacs、git、python、lisp 之类,但这些开源软件对 windows 很不友好,总是有各种各样的小毛病。所以打算转到 Linux 下。我觉得这种情景下 Raspberry Pi 有可能不够用。

    至于 Windows,我是扔不掉的。有些事情必须在 Windows 上完成。
    63 条回复    1970-01-01 08:00:00 +08:00
    RHFS
        1
    RHFS  
       2013-08-15 09:54:16 +08:00
    。。。Virtualbox 免费,方便,快捷。
    FreeWriting
        2
    FreeWriting  
    OP
       2013-08-15 10:00:47 +08:00
    @RHFS 谢谢,不过我不太习惯虚拟机。可能是我电脑本身配置不太好,再加上觉得切来切去的很麻烦,每次用虚拟机到最后都不了了之,懒得用了
    typing
        3
    typing  
       2013-08-15 10:01:10 +08:00
    同意楼上不能更多.

    你花费的选配件的时间, 能学好多东西了呢.
    welsonla
        4
    welsonla  
       2013-08-15 10:02:43 +08:00
    ubuntu,双系统
    FanError
        5
    FanError  
       2013-08-15 10:04:37 +08:00
    买个便宜点的vps
    revlis7
        6
    revlis7  
       2013-08-15 10:05:31 +08:00   ❤️ 1
    不用切啊,开个虚拟机基本都是最小化的,登录个putty就可以敲命令了,难道你要学习的是linux的图形界面?
    banbanchs
        7
    banbanchs  
       2013-08-15 10:08:29 +08:00
    g2020+主板+8G+硬盘,便宜省事
    ipconfiger
        8
    ipconfiger  
       2013-08-15 10:12:29 +08:00
    去搞个linode最小那一号的VPS,可以搭网站,还能翻墙,学习了linux,一年开销1.5K以内。你配台机器要多少钱?
    refresh
        9
    refresh  
       2013-08-15 10:16:14 +08:00
    把配机器的钱,升级现在的机器,ssd + 16g||32g的内存,虚拟机开N个linux,你看飞起来不
    yylzcom
        10
    yylzcom  
       2013-08-15 10:21:13 +08:00
    1. 树莓派装个定制版的debian
    2. 安卓mini pc(就那种电视棒)装个picuntu
    3. mini itx主机装个linux

    以上三种是最经济实效的方法,毕竟linux下玩游戏的不多,也不方便。上面这几个配置学习命令,熟悉系统完全都够用了。

    如果是pc机,推荐unbuntu系列,用习惯了服务器上的debian也容易上手,喜欢轻巧的就xubuntu,还有openbox的定制版,比如archbang(archlinux),crunchbang(debian)。
    jiumingmao
        11
    jiumingmao  
       2013-08-15 10:25:31 +08:00
    raspberry pi 最便宜了
    s2marine
        12
    s2marine  
       2013-08-15 10:30:41 +08:00   ❤️ 1
    想学Linux?直接全盘格了装
    不然每次遇到困难你就会想着回到win下解决
    saharabear
        13
    saharabear  
       2013-08-15 10:32:48 +08:00
    thinkpad t43, thinkpad t60,都可以。几百块钱。
    davepkxxx
        14
    davepkxxx  
       2013-08-15 10:33:12 +08:00
    @s2marine 比如连不上网?
    jamesxu
        15
    jamesxu  
       2013-08-15 10:34:08 +08:00
    楼上几个就别瞎掺和了,人家是要学习linux,估计就命令行什么的,不是折腾嵌入式的。
    建议楼主自己配个机子吧,vps和虚拟机都差不多,你了解不了真实硬件。配台电脑从分区什么的开始学吧,最好买intel cpu的,就核芯显卡就行了,要独显就买nvidia的卡,内存4g够你用了。
    xunyu
        16
    xunyu  
       2013-08-15 10:39:19 +08:00
    jiumingmao +1
    ashin
        17
    ashin  
       2013-08-15 10:41:09 +08:00   ❤️ 1
    双系统吧骚年,再配个burg,享受开机快感
    ohhe
        18
    ohhe  
       2013-08-15 10:41:19 +08:00
    双系统不是最好的方案吗
    chemzqm
        19
    chemzqm  
       2013-08-15 10:46:23 +08:00
    买个vps
    skyangel3
        20
    skyangel3  
       2013-08-15 10:46:28 +08:00
    @revlis7 多谢了, 发现putty可以用来本地虚拟主机, 每次都要ctrl+alt 切换真累啊。
    terry
        21
    terry  
       2013-08-15 10:49:11 +08:00
    Raspberry Pi 跑 Raspbian 或者 Arch Linux ARM 挂掉直接换张 SD 卡又可以跑了。原来的卡可以直接挂载起来修,备份...
    fiture
        22
    fiture  
       2013-08-15 10:51:48 +08:00
    最好的办法时装虚拟机,然后其次是装双系统,其次直接装Linux的发行版,最后买树莓派+一个显示器。
    zhanggggfd
        23
    zhanggggfd  
       2013-08-15 10:51:54 +08:00
    要不我把我的旧笔记本卖你吧...掩面……
    sarices
        24
    sarices  
       2013-08-15 10:57:55 +08:00
    分配512内存妥妥的~其实256也很稳定,128也勉强可以玩玩
    FreeWriting
        25
    FreeWriting  
    OP
       2013-08-15 11:12:27 +08:00
    谢谢各位的回答。

    我可能没说明白,我不只是想学 Linux CLI,而是想学习在 Linux 下的开发。之前一直在 Windows 中使用和学习 emacs、git、python、lisp 之类,但这些开源软件对 windows 很不友好,总是有各种各样的小毛病。所以打算转到 Linux 下。我觉得这种情景下 Raspberry Pi 有可能不够用。

    至于 Windows,我是扔不掉的。有些事情必须在 Windows 上完成。
    fishsjoy
        26
    fishsjoy  
       2013-08-15 11:19:33 +08:00
    vagrant完了,命令行占不了多少资源,putty连接。
    raptor
        27
    raptor  
       2013-08-15 11:20:07 +08:00   ❤️ 1
    把电脑装成linux,windows放虚拟机跑,时间长了就适应了
    shawngao
        28
    shawngao  
       2013-08-15 11:51:19 +08:00
    我来说几句:
    1. 用Linux就是用命令行,不要图形界面 (当然你可以在虚拟机上跑了感受感受就行了)
    2. 物多不为罪,浪费时间才是真浪费。 有能力的话就配台主机,不编译android rom类似的项目话,
    客厅主机就成了,1K+。
    3. 我现在装双系统是笔记本上装,出去的时候方便。
    4. VPS是最好的方案,但是最好你是有了一些经验之后再去操作。
    Sdhjt
        29
    Sdhjt  
       2013-08-15 12:18:40 +08:00
    系统使用Ubuntu(桌面华丽,不过占资源稍多,有些卡)或者LUbuntu(Ubuntu+轻量级桌面,推荐这个系统)
    以上两个系统最好用64位的,毕竟你倾向于开发,以后编一个android rom也方便。
    CPU用Intel的,显卡用NVIDIA的,主要考虑到Linux对硬件兼容性不是很好,用流行的硬件,Linux支持多一些。比如NVIDIA的不开源驱动就比AMD的好一些。CPU用i3的就可以。

    内存4G,最好能配8G,如果再配一块SSD,那就非常爽了。
    leavic
        30
    leavic  
       2013-08-15 12:38:57 +08:00
    你硬盘是有多小啊,不喜欢虚拟机就装个双系统呗
    FrankFang128
        31
    FrankFang128  
       2013-08-15 12:41:08 +08:00
    以前我也以为我人不掉Windows,直到我用上了Mac。
    tomyiyun
        32
    tomyiyun  
       2013-08-15 13:30:18 +08:00
    最快捷的学习Linux的办法就是先格式化掉Windows几个月

    你认为必须在Windows下完成的那些事情,建议就先都忍几个月再干吧
    Carlos_Gong
        33
    Carlos_Gong  
       2013-08-15 14:45:51 +08:00
    为什么要另配呢,自己现在的电脑,拿出 20G 装个双系统,学习为目的的话肯定够了~

    硬盘发展到今天这个份上,应该不会有人特别纠结少掉 20G 的空间了吧~
    Galileo
        34
    Galileo  
       2013-08-15 15:02:49 +08:00
    双系统。如果不用来娱乐什么的,划个20G足够了,装个Ubuntu,就可以开始玩了!
    openroc
        35
    openroc  
       2013-08-15 15:06:18 +08:00
    上mac吧
    ipconfiger
        36
    ipconfiger  
       2013-08-15 15:36:25 +08:00   ❤️ 2
    http://www.cnblogs.com/Alexander-Lee/archive/2010/07/19/1780660.html 看看我当年是怎么彻底断了后路抛弃windows的,当年2000都不到神舟上网本,装个ubuntu就上路了,逢山开路遇水搭桥,3个月后就能在linux下解决所有的问题了,包括开发
    ipconfiger
        37
    ipconfiger  
       2013-08-15 15:37:09 +08:00
    男人就是要对自己狠一点
    @FreeWriting
    lisposter
        38
    lisposter  
       2013-08-15 15:41:03 +08:00
    不能同意楼上更多了,不做设计的,没啥理由扔不掉windows,虽然我已在奔向mac的路上
    FreeWriting
        39
    FreeWriting  
    OP
       2013-08-15 16:47:59 +08:00
    @ipconfiger 哈哈,谢谢各位鼓励我摆脱 Windows。我不是计算机相关行业的,而是学工程的,别人用 Windows 我也得用 Windows。我学编程只是爱好而已。

    至于日常使用,之前尝试过。Linux 少一些小工具,比如 Evernote 之类,不太方便。而且有的软件时不时的崩溃。折腾的时候花了太多时间,怕了。

    如果我能靠编程赚钱的话,我会考虑换 Mac。但现在纯爱好而已,上 Mac 有点贵了。
    maxiujun
        40
    maxiujun  
       2013-08-15 16:52:46 +08:00
    zhiguoma
        41
    zhiguoma  
       2013-08-15 16:54:49 +08:00
    8G以上内存+SSD,开个Virtualbox跟玩似的,基本不存在卡顿的现象。
    最关键的是这些配件以后都能用得上。
    单独买一台机器用Linux不必要,而且要处理一堆的驱动、数据同步等问题。
    如果想用得更加放心,可以用vagrant之类的来管理虚拟机,出问题了一键恢复。
    scola
        42
    scola  
       2013-08-15 16:57:42 +08:00   ❤️ 1
    二手thinkpad,我是这样解决的
    felix021
        43
    felix021  
       2013-08-15 17:03:24 +08:00
    @jiumingmao 没有MK802便宜……你要充分相信国产的实力。

    felix021@felix021-mk802:~$ uptime
    17:03:51 up 115 days, 20:40, 2 users, load average: 1.16, 1.05, 1.06
    airwalker
        44
    airwalker  
       2013-08-15 17:08:47 +08:00
    用easybcd安装linux
    不用再配台电脑,原來的机器就能解決
    ipconfiger
        45
    ipconfiger  
       2013-08-15 17:15:58 +08:00
    kopp123
        46
    kopp123  
       2013-08-15 17:24:36 +08:00
    我觉得你应该学习计算机基础知识。
    snip
        47
    snip  
       2013-08-15 17:34:43 +08:00
    我也是觉得二手本最方便了
    binyuJ
        48
    binyuJ  
       2013-08-15 17:35:39 +08:00
    为什么要另配?直接双系统就可以了
    msg7086
        49
    msg7086  
       2013-08-15 17:52:04 +08:00
    @ipconfiger 如果用的不多的话当然可以扔windows。
    像我们经常要win/nix两边做开发的人来说就离不开了。

    比如directshow,总不能老用wine模拟吧。
    orzjerry
        50
    orzjerry  
       2013-08-15 17:53:52 +08:00
    想学就要下狠手,逼着自己上!不能双系统或者虚拟机,我就是直接格掉上的fedora
    momo5269
        51
    momo5269  
       2013-08-15 18:03:20 +08:00
    加块硬盘;1000左右的二手台式机(含显示器);1500左右的二手本;2000-3000左右的神州本(可以换U加内存);
    cad0420
        52
    cad0420  
       2013-08-15 18:35:45 +08:00
    表示自己是小白,然后在网上搜了帖子,照着在自己用的老笔记本上分了50G出来,用U盘安装的。没用虚拟机。现在windows慢到死,ubuntu更新了几遍还是快的飞起。之前安装过的时候,没有改引导区,然后就杯具了。后来重做了系统,用了easyBCD,把引导区改回windows的,现在各种好~不过还是建议用linux的grub,只是我觉得紫色的开机画面很不爽。。。所以。。
    建议楼主不要学习我,贸然行动,先看看《鸟哥linux私房菜 基础篇》(见:http://vbird.dic.ksu.edu.tw/linux_basic/linux_basic.php),把前面几章的基础知识好好看看,然后再装。
    yiqingfeng
        53
    yiqingfeng  
       2013-08-15 18:56:21 +08:00
    便宜的VPS是个好选。
    chloerei
        54
    chloerei  
       2013-08-15 19:03:52 +08:00
    双系统,觉得性能不够用再买。能跑 windows 的电脑一般跑 Linux 也没问题,Linux 桌面环境也有不同量级适用不同性能的机器。
    wontoncc
        55
    wontoncc  
       2013-08-15 19:45:33 +08:00
    我一直有意愿完全迁移到 Linux,但是要在虚拟机里面跑电路仿真软件我觉得还是当开玩笑算了…
    kaifengjin
        56
    kaifengjin  
       2013-08-15 21:00:29 +08:00
    >至于 Windows,我是扔不掉的。有些事情必须在 Windows 上完成

    原来我也是这么想,可是后来我真的丢掉了。Windows上除了玩游戏,还有什么只能在windows上做?玩游戏dota2都有ubuntu客户端了。。。
    gdm
        57
    gdm  
       2013-08-15 23:24:45 +08:00
    同意9楼,内存升级到8g,再买个ssd,不用太大,两样一共八百。双系统+虚拟机,小玩和双开用虚拟机,大玩切系统。
    对某些人来说很多非常重要的简单小事在 linux 下干不成,比如下载超星的书,工具全是 windows 下的。还有我想吐槽一下, linux 的文本编辑器那么多,为什么就没有一款类似 emeditor/editplus/everedit 那样易上手且功能齐全好用的呢?用了差不多一年 linux ,最后怒删了。
    ouankou
        58
    ouankou  
       2013-08-15 23:39:27 +08:00
    如果LZ对Windows依赖性不是特别强,只是个别轻量软件的话,可以考虑Linux做主系统,虚拟机里跑Windows。如果一半一半的话,建议虚拟机跑Linux,比双系统的优点是,对于主系统的安全性更有保证,两个系统不会相互影响,造成数据丢失之类的问题。而且你主要目的是学习编程的话,不会有很大的性能和储集空间要求,虚拟机完全可以满足。专门单独买个电脑有点夸张,在数据同步上比较麻烦,而且你很难同时用两台电脑,大部分时间都有一台是闲置浪费的。

    @kaifengjin 就像@wontoncc说的,有些专业软件,真的只能在Windows下跑,就算Linux有替代软件,经常也是不完美的,重要场景下肯定不能冒不兼容,临场掉链子的风险。
    SharkIng
        59
    SharkIng  
       2013-08-16 00:26:18 +08:00
    有钱的话买一个VPS或者云服务器之类的,但是你只能用SSH链接,或者就去买一个电脑双电脑用,推荐Mac OS的但是买一个PC装一个Ubuntu也可以

    个人不是很喜欢双系统,因为切换需要重启很是麻烦,虚拟机不错但是#2楼说了不喜欢虚拟就就不说了
    funcman
        60
    funcman  
       2013-08-16 03:31:49 +08:00
    如果手头不宽裕,可以买一台500块的电脑,只要内存足,就能顺畅地跑Linux。

    我是建议再弄台机器只装Linux别搞双系统。
    刚玩Linux,一时找不到功能,你就需要Windows应急。
    切系统太麻烦,搞到后来基本上都是Linux没开过几次。

    SSH连接VPS的用法,敲键盘有延时,不爽快。
    虚拟机可以,但是多少还是比真机差点。

    个人使用Linux,应该使用桌面,而不是Console。
    桌面里可以用Console,Console却缺乏桌面能提供的功能。
    而这些功能都是与个人用户有关的。
    另外,目前gnome3和unity都太怪异,建议使用拿KDE当桌面的系统如Kubuntu。
    机器显卡差,桌面卡顿,可以通过关闭特效,获取流畅的体验。

    学Linux时,少折腾,减少难度,多取得一些成功感。
    我有好几年拿Linux做主力工作系统的经验,希望能帮助你。

    这一贴我最认同@ipconfiger的看法。
    但是LZ有些需求必须由Windows来完成,我就不好推荐这种釜底抽薪大法。
    davidyin
        61
    davidyin  
       2013-08-16 07:12:34 +08:00
    两个选择:
    1)桌面机器内存够的话,用Virtualbox
    2)购买VPS,月付的就可以,最低的那款,通常是$5一个月。
    kfc315
        62
    kfc315  
       2013-08-16 10:25:06 +08:00
    装个虚拟机,然后开起来之后扔后台,SSH 上去多好…… 再差的电脑也不会卡哪儿去啊……
    itaotao
        63
    itaotao  
       2013-08-16 10:56:40 +08:00
    双系统。。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1391 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 23:52 · PVG 07:52 · LAX 15:52 · JFK 18:52
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.